一,解析过程   二,硬解析,软解析,软软解析  01,硬解析    将SQL语句通过监听器发送到Oracle时, 会触发一个Server process生成,来对该客户进程服务。Server process得到SQL语句之后,对SQL语句进行Hash运算,然后根据Hash值到library cache中查找,如果存在,则直接将library cache中的缓存的执行计划拿来执行,最后将
转载 2024-09-24 20:04:50
115阅读
是一个黄金组合,项目规模和复杂度来挑选合适的 ORM 库。的组合,这是现代软件开发中非常流行且强大的一个技术栈,尤其适合中小型应用、移动应用、桌面应用和嵌入式系统。
转载 26天前
0阅读
## Android SQLite ORM实现步骤 ### 概述 在Android开发中,使用SQLite数据库是非常常见的需求。而为了方便操作和管理数据库,我们可以使用ORM(对象关系映射)框架来简化开发流程。本文将向你介绍如何实现Android中的SQLite ORM。 ### ORM框架选择 在Android中,有许多不同的ORM框架可供选择,例如GreenDAO、Room和Active
原创 2023-12-18 06:47:06
41阅读
目录一、ORM简介1.什么是ORM2.ORM如何实现持久化1.非ORM的持久化方案2.ORM的持久化方案二、ORM实现原理三、了解1.ORM的概念2.ORM的优缺点一、ORM简介1.什么是ORM1.对象关系映射(Object Relational Mapping,简称ORM)模式是一种为了解决面向对象与关系数据库存在的互不匹配的现象的技术2.简单的说,ORM是通过使用描述对象和数据库之间映射的元数
转载 2024-02-28 13:02:21
123阅读
# 使用 Python ORM 框架与 SQLite 的简单指南 在我们进行数据库开发时,使用 ORM(对象关系映射)框架可以大大简化与数据库的交互。本文将向你展示如何使用 Python 的 SQLAlchemy ORMSQLite 数据库。以下是整个流程的简要步骤: | 步骤 | 描述 | |------|------------------
原创 2024-10-22 03:47:49
158阅读
最近在学习Android的开发,一接触到数据库,就像有没有像Hibernate 那样好用的ORM工具呢,到网上找了下,还真有呢!叫ORMLITEhttp://ormlite.com/sqlite_java_android_orm.shtml
原创 2022-05-05 22:25:24
218阅读
## Python SQLite ORM工具实现流程 为了帮助这位刚入行的小白开发者学会实现Python SQLite ORM工具,我们将按照以下步骤来详细解释。 ### 步骤1:创建数据库连接 在使用Python SQLite ORM工具之前,需要创建与数据库的连接。可以使用`sqlite3`模块中的`connect`方法来创建连接对象。 ```python import sqlite3
原创 2023-08-01 05:01:20
252阅读
在当今的Python开发中,使用SQLite作为轻量级数据库已成为一种常见实践。通过ORM(对象关系映射)框架,我们可以更高效地与数据库进行交互。在这篇文章中,我将详细列出解决“python的sqlite ORM框架”相关问题的过程,并将其分为几个部分,包含环境配置、编译过程、参数调优、定制开发、生态集成和进阶指南等,以便大家可以在实际项目中迅速应用。 ### 环境配置 为了开始使用SQLit
原创 6月前
105阅读
前言一直想对数据库的操作进行一个用法整理,翻开现在比较火的GreenDao,里
原创 2022-11-04 11:38:45
623阅读
# Python sqliteorm框架实现指南 ## 引言 在Python开发中,使用sqlite数据库是非常常见的。为了方便操作数据库,我们通常会使用ORM(对象关系映射)框架。ORM框架可以让我们直接使用Python对象来操作数据库,而不需要编写SQL语句。本文将指导你如何实现一个简单的Python sqliteORM框架。 ## 整体流程 下面是实现Python sqlite的OR
原创 2023-09-11 12:26:05
747阅读
在springboot项目里面,一般是不建议使用jsp页面的,但是还是可以使用的,我们通过springboot的启动类进行启动项目,是不识别jsp页面的,所以不同通过启动类进行启动,现在我们要使用其他的方法1 导入一个启动插件的依赖<dependency> <groupId>org.springframework.boot</groupId&g
# Python ORM(Object Relational Mapping) with SQLite3 ## 目录 1. 介绍 2. 安装SQLite3 3. 创建数据库连接 4. 创建数据表 5. 定义模型类 6. 增删改查操作 7. 总结 ## 1. 介绍 在开发过程中,我们经常需要与数据库进行交互,用于存储和检索数据。Python提供了许多不同的方法来处理数据库操作,其中一种常见的方法
原创 2023-11-22 10:01:10
57阅读
前言:简介ORM什么是ORM?它能带给我们什么优势?ORM:Object对象,Relations关系、Mapping映射。简称:对象关系映射对象关系映射是通过面向对象的方式来操作数据库,这就需要对应的关系映射,数据中可以分为库,表,字段信息,一条条数据,而需要用面向对象的关系去对应。于是就有了下面对应关系。数据库 ======= 面向对象模型 表 ======= 类 字段 ======= 类属性
转载 2023-11-09 15:23:09
488阅读
-     前言     -本文将全面揭秘 SQL 语句性能优化策略,直接上干货!-     52 条 SQL 语句性能优化策略     -1、对查询进行优化,应尽量避免全表扫描,首先应考虑在where及order by涉及的列上建立索引。2、应尽量避免在where子句中对字段进
要写一个词法分析,首先是要对一段 sql 进行解析,然后将其解析为一个一个的 token.每个 token 是都特定含义的,固定义 token 结构如下: /** • token for sql. */ public final class SQLToken { // 可能称为类型更合适些, 用于标识解析出来的 token 的类型. // 比如 select, insert, 字符串, i
在现代应用程序开发中,使用SQLite作为轻量级数据库的场景越来越常见。与Java相结合,为应用提供了较好的数据存储解决方案。本文将详细记录我在“Java 解析SQLite”过程中所经历的背景定位、演进历程、架构设计、性能攻坚、复盘总结和扩展应用的每一个环节。 ### 背景定位 在进行数据管理的项目中,我负责实现一个基于Java的客户端应用,而数据存储选择了SQLite,因为它在小型和中型应用
原创 6月前
12阅读
今天来解读下Django的源码内容,也算在中秋节完成一次技术任务。
原创 2021-07-21 11:25:10
1468阅读
引言:没想到这sqlite的语法和Mysql差异还是挺多的,搞得只好先去看看Sqlite的语法再来写一开始我使用的是sqflite来操作sqlite数据库,原声的执行sql来操作数据库又有人提了,得用orm框架,好吧,然后推了这个jaguar_query_sqflite,刚按照官网的英文教程来操作的,可行,因此写上这篇博客
原创 2021-07-06 10:07:26
195阅读
本文对比了Python中操作SQLite的两种方式:原生sqlite3模块和Peewee ORMsqlite3作为标准库模块,需要手动编写SQL语句并处理连接管理,适合简单脚本和熟悉SQL的开发者;而Peewee通过面向对象的方式封装数据库操作,自动处理SQL生成和连接管理,简化了CRUD操作,更适合中大型项目和团队协作。两者在数据定义、操作方式、连接管理、跨库兼容性等方面存在显著差异。选择时应考虑项目规模、团队技术栈和长期维护需求:原生方式适合轻量级应用,Peewee则更适合需要高开发效率和可维护性的场
转载 19天前
0阅读
Android:数据库增删改查、SQLiteORM、Cursor
原创 2013-06-05 21:52:00
944阅读
  • 1
  • 2
  • 3
  • 4
  • 5